Features a Snorkeling Watch Needs

Galen's snorkeling watch
Galen’s Casio Solar Powered Snorkeling Watch

What is a snorkeling watch? Really it can be any watch that is fully waterproof.

Get a minimum of 100 meters water-resistance. All of our suggested watches below meet this standard. Many waterproof “dive” watches actually say in their fine print they are good for snorkeling but not sport diving. But with a watch rated to 100 meters you don’t need to be afraid to freedive down for a closer look or a picture.

How much to spend? Our top pick is around $20. We focus on options below $300 that offer good value and features. But the sky’s the limit with dive watches.

Digital vs. analog? The majority of highly water resistant watches are analog time pieces. This is likely because digital watches tend to need more buttons that are more difficult to keep sealed. Although it is not hard to find waterproof digital watches like Galen’s Casio Pro Trek PRG-300 pictured above.

What type of band? Avoid leather and fabric bands on a snorkeling watch. They don’t dry well. Get a plastic, rubber, or stainless steel band.

Vibrating Alarm? – One of our readers bought the Timex Expedition watch, because it offers vibration alarm alerts so he can keep track of how long he is in the water. He reports it “…is unexpectedly great. I can feel the vibe and hear the chime clearly at all depths”.

Important watch care – After you snorkel you need to soak your watch in fresh water, just like your camera, to dissolve the salt crystals. Otherwise, don’t expect it to last long.

Casio Snorkeling Watch – Best Value

Casio makes a mind boggling variety of watches that are well made and waterproof to 100 meters, 200 meters, or more. Some handy features you might like on a snorkeling trip are world time, alarms, and solar power.

Casio MRW200H watch
Our pick in this category.

Casio Men’s Sport Analog Snorkeling Watch
The Casio MRW200H (on Amazon) is good looking, super affordable, waterproof to 100 meters, and also shows the date. It’s available in a variety of face and band colors. It’s so affordable that if it fails it is no hardship. You really can’t go wrong.

Seiko – High Quality, Japanese Technology

Seiko has been a leader in waterproof dive watches for years. You don’t really need a dive watch as a snorkeler, but these are beautiful precision watches that will look good out of the water when traveling. Yes they cost more than the options above, but not compared to a Rolex, Ocean Master, or other high end options that cost in the thousands.
